TDIC Involves collaboration with various
individuals, groups and Institutions
that are interested to join through
various ways:
Direct Contribution:
Development partners wishing to promote
knowledge and information for development
can make cash or in-kind contribution
to support the running cost of the centre.
Development Dialogue:
Development organizations or institutions
conducting development dialogues can
rent TDIC facilities and connect to
partners worldwide through the Global
Development Learning Network (GDLN)
www.gdln.org
Books and Display:
Development partners can sell their
publications on consignment, donate
books, CD-ROM & Video to the Library,
or place their brochures for free distribution
, and can exhibit their displays on
TDIC display pannels.
